Duanna Johnson, a trans woman who was beaten by two Memphis police officers back in February, was found murdered the night before last. This was shortly after signing the papers to file a lawsuit against MPD and the two officers involved, both of whom were fired in the wake of the bad publicity surrounding the MPD, which was not until late summer after the now-infamous beating video was leaked to the media. She was also helping with a federal investigation involving the MPD. While her courage sparked the local movement to stop police profiling and brutality against trans women of color, her death will not stop community scrutiny of the MPD, nor will it silence the multitude of voices condemning its policies and bigotry. It is interesting that director Godwin has not yet charged the two criminally and has been more interested in finding out who leaked the video and charging them with interfering with an investigation.
